Output d980a690815cf56e7a413f722a8bf2e7765ac554e0840dcd2136dcf4f6da3147:0

value
30903308
script pubkey
OP_0 OP_PUSHBYTES_20 5907e2e51452c3d9795c494b7dd5d005e01b8b4c
address
bc1qtyr79eg52tpaj72uf99hm4wsqhsphz6vzh2x69
transaction
d980a690815cf56e7a413f722a8bf2e7765ac554e0840dcd2136dcf4f6da3147
confirmations
69751
spent
false